Holger Weiss 6f026ca26d Integrate nicely with systemd
Support systemd's watchdog feature and enable it by default in the unit
file, so that ejabberd is auto-restarted if the VM becomes unresponsive.
Also, set the systemd startup type to 'notify', so that startup of
followup units is delayed until ejabberd signals readiness.  While at
it, also notify systemd of configuration reload and shutdown states.

Note: "NotifyAccess=all" is required as long as "ejabberdctl foreground"
runs the VM as a new child process, rather than "exec"ing it.  This way,
systemd views the ejabberdctl process itself as the main service
process, and would discard notifications from other processes by
default.

-module(ejabberd_app).
-author('alexey@process-one.net').
-behaviour(application).
-export([start/2, prep_stop/1, stop/1]).
-include("logger.hrl").
-include("ejabberd_stacktrace.hrl").
%%%
%%% Application API
%%%
start(normal, _Args) ->
try
{T1, _} = statistics(wall_clock),
ejabberd_logger:start(),
write_pid_file(),
start_included_apps(),
start_elixir_application(),
setup_if_elixir_conf_used(),
case ejabberd_config:load() of
ok ->
ejabberd_mnesia:start(),
file_queue_init(),
maybe_add_nameservers(),
case ejabberd_sup:start_link() of
{ok, SupPid} ->
ejabberd_system_monitor:start(),
register_elixir_config_hooks(),
ejabberd_cluster:wait_for_sync(infinity),
ejabberd_hooks:run(ejabberd_started, []),
ejabberd:check_apps(),
ejabberd_systemd:ready(),
{T2, _} = statistics(wall_clock),
?INFO_MSG("ejabberd ~ts is started in the node ~p in ~.2fs",
[ejabberd_option:version(),
node(), (T2-T1)/1000]),
{ok, SupPid};
Err ->
?CRITICAL_MSG("Failed to start ejabberd application: ~p", [Err]),
ejabberd:halt()
end;
Err ->
?CRITICAL_MSG("Failed to start ejabberd application: ~ts",
[ejabberd_config:format_error(Err)]),
ejabberd:halt()
end
catch throw:{?MODULE, Error} ->
?DEBUG("Failed to start ejabberd application: ~p", [Error]),
ejabberd:halt()
end;
start(_, _) ->
{error, badarg}.
start_included_apps() ->
{ok, Apps} = application:get_key(ejabberd, included_applications),
lists:foreach(
fun(mnesia) ->
ok;
(lager) ->
ok;
(os_mon)->
ok;
(App) ->
application:ensure_all_started(App)
end, Apps).
%% Prepare the application for termination.
%% This function is called when an application is about to be stopped,
%% before shutting down the processes of the application.
prep_stop(State) ->
ejabberd_systemd:stopping(),
ejabberd_hooks:run(ejabberd_stopping, []),
ejabberd_listener:stop(),
ejabberd_sm:stop(),
ejabberd_service:stop(),
ejabberd_s2s:stop(),
gen_mod:stop(),
State.
%% All the processes were killed when this function is called
stop(_State) ->
?INFO_MSG("ejabberd ~ts is stopped in the node ~p",
[ejabberd_option:version(), node()]),
delete_pid_file().
%%%
%%% Internal functions
%%%
%% If ejabberd is running on some Windows machine, get nameservers and add to Erlang
maybe_add_nameservers() ->
case os:type() of
{win32, _} -> add_windows_nameservers();
_ -> ok
end.
add_windows_nameservers() ->
IPTs = win32_dns:get_nameservers(),
?INFO_MSG("Adding machine's DNS IPs to Erlang system:~n~p", [IPTs]),
lists:foreach(fun(IPT) -> inet_db:add_ns(IPT) end, IPTs).
%%%
%%% PID file
%%%
write_pid_file() ->
case ejabberd:get_pid_file() of
false ->
ok;
PidFilename ->
write_pid_file(os:getpid(), PidFilename)
end.
write_pid_file(Pid, PidFilename) ->
case file:write_file(PidFilename, io_lib:format("~ts~n", [Pid])) of
ok ->
ok;
{error, Reason} = Err ->
?CRITICAL_MSG("Cannot write PID file ~ts: ~ts",
[PidFilename, file:format_error(Reason)]),
throw({?MODULE, Err})
end.
delete_pid_file() ->
case ejabberd:get_pid_file() of
false ->
ok;
PidFilename ->
file:delete(PidFilename)
end.
file_queue_init() ->
QueueDir = case ejabberd_option:queue_dir() of
undefined ->
MnesiaDir = mnesia:system_info(directory),
filename:join(MnesiaDir, "queue");
Path ->
Path
end,
case p1_queue:start(QueueDir) of
ok -> ok;
Err -> throw({?MODULE, Err})
end.
-ifdef(ELIXIR_ENABLED).
is_using_elixir_config() ->
Config = ejabberd_config:path(),
'Elixir.Ejabberd.ConfigUtil':is_elixir_config(Config).
setup_if_elixir_conf_used() ->
case is_using_elixir_config() of
true -> 'Elixir.Ejabberd.Config.Store':start_link();
false -> ok
end.
register_elixir_config_hooks() ->
case is_using_elixir_config() of
true -> 'Elixir.Ejabberd.Config':start_hooks();
false -> ok
end.
start_elixir_application() ->
case application:ensure_started(elixir) of
ok -> ok;
{error, _Msg} -> ?ERROR_MSG("Elixir application not started.", [])
end.
-else.
setup_if_elixir_conf_used() -> ok.
register_elixir_config_hooks() -> ok.
start_elixir_application() -> ok.
-endif.
